The Waitemata

Waitemata is a harbour in New Zealand that provides the main access by sea to Auckland. That is why it is also known as Auckland Harbour even though it is only one of the two harbours that joins the city. The northern and eastern coasts of isthmus, Auckland, is formed by this harbour. It is crossed by the Harbour bridge of Auckland. Covering the North Shore city, Waitakere City and Rodney district, Waitemata DHB is based in Takapuna. Approximately 628970 people live here.
